No parity laws are providing for coverage and payment of telehealth services in hawaii of Florida.
With regards to health insurers and telehealth providers, voluntary contracts with terms and conditions mutually agreed upon by both parties shall govern their reimbursement policies.
Telehealth practitioners must observe the same prevailing standard of care in their delivery of services as they are mandated to supply in-person healthcare services.
Their practice is bound to the scope of these field of expertise and people located within Florida.
The state has generated a Telehealth Advisory Council responsible for making recommendations that could improve both practice and delivery of this kind of service.

If you’ve previously been prescribed a stimulant-based medication, like Adderall, and you know that it is effective for you, you’ll actually have to go with a company like Done.
Because not all companies that claim to treat ADHD online actually prescribe stimulants like Adderall.
